Skip to main content

Bagaimana Membuat Fail EPUB Dari HTML dan XML

Fix Microsoft Edge becoming default application for PDF Acrobat file (April 2025)

Fix Microsoft Edge becoming default application for PDF Acrobat file (April 2025)
Anonim

Fail EPUB adalah jenis fail ebook lain yang popular. Jika anda merancang menulis atau menerbitkan ebook, anda harus menyimpan HTML anda sebagai fail Mobipocket, dan juga sebagai EPUB. Dalam beberapa cara, fail epub lebih mudah dibina daripada fail Mobi. Oleh kerana EPUB berasaskan XML, anda hanya perlu membuat fail XML anda, mengumpulnya bersama, dan memanggilnya epub.

Bagaimana Membuat Fail EPUB Dari HTML dan XML

Ini adalah langkah-langkah yang perlu anda ambil untuk membuat fail epub:

  1. Bina HTML anda.Buku anda ditulis dalam HTML, dengan CSS untuk gaya. Tetapi, bukan hanya HTML, itu XHTML. Oleh itu, jika anda tidak biasanya menulis dalam XHTML (menutup elemen anda, menggunakan petikan di semua atribut, dan sebagainya), anda perlu menukar HTML anda ke XHTML. Anda boleh menggunakan satu atau lebih fail XHTML untuk buku anda. Kebanyakan orang memisahkan bab ke dalam fail XHTML berasingan. Sebaik sahaja anda mempunyai semua fail XHTML, letakkannya dalam folder semua bersama-sama.
  2. Buat Fail Jenis MIME.Dalam editor teks anda, buka dokumen dan jenis baharu:

    permohonan / epub + zip Simpan fail sebagai "mimetype" tanpa sebarang pelanjutan . Letakkan fail itu dalam folder dengan fail XHTML anda.

  3. Tambah helaian gaya anda.Anda harus membuat dua helaian gaya untuk buku anda untuk halaman yang dipanggil
    1. page_styles.css:

      @page {

  4. margin-bottom: 5pt;

  5. margin-top: 5pt

  6. }

    1. Buat satu untuk gaya buku yang dipanggil

      stylesheet.css. Anda boleh memberi mereka nama-nama lain, anda hanya perlu ingat apa yang mereka ada. Simpan fail ini dalam direktori yang sama dengan fail XHTML dan mimetype anda.

  7. Tambah imej perlindungan anda.Imej perlindungan anda hendaklah menjadi fail JPG tidak lebih daripada 64KB. Semakin kecil anda boleh menjadikannya lebih baik, tetapi teruskan dengan baik. Imej-imej kecil boleh menjadi sangat sukar untuk dibaca, dan penutupnya adalah di mana anda melakukan pemasaran buku anda.
  8. Bina halaman tajuk anda.Anda tidak perlu menggunakan imej penutup sebagai halaman tajuk anda, tetapi kebanyakan orang lakukan. Untuk menambah halaman tajuk anda, buat fail XHTML yang dipanggil

    titlepage.xhtml. Berikut adalah contoh halaman tajuk menggunakan SVG untuk imej. Tukar bahagian yang diketengahkan untuk menunjuk pada imej perlindungan anda:

  9. Tutup

  10. Bina "Isi Kandungan" anda.Buat fail yang dipanggil

    toc.ncx dalam editor teks anda. Ini adalah fail XML, dan ia harus menunjuk kepada semua fail HTML anda dalam buku anda. Berikut adalah sampel dengan dua elemen dalam jadual kandungan. Tukar bahagian yang diserlahkan ke buku anda, dan tambah tambahan

    navPoint unsur untuk bahagian tambahan:

  11. Cara Membina Laman Web

  12. Hosting

  13. Adakah Anda Perlu Nama Domain?

  14. Tambah fail XML kontena.Dalam editor teks anda, buat fail yang dipanggil

    container.xml dan simpan dalam sub-direktori di bawah fail HTML anda. Fail harus dibaca:

  15. Buat senarai kandungan (

    content.opf). Ini adalah fail yang menjelaskan apa buku epub anda. Ia termasuk metadata mengenai buku (seperti penulis, tarikh penerbitan, dan genre). Berikut ialah contoh, anda perlu menukar bahagian dalam kuning untuk mencerminkan buku anda:

  16. en

  17. Cara Membina Laman Web

  18. Jennifer Kyrnin
  19. 0101-01-01T00: 00: 00 + 00: 00
  20. 0c159d12-f5fe-4323-8194-f5c652b89f5c
  21. Itulah semua fail yang anda perlukan, mereka semua harus berada dalam direktori bersama (kecuali untuk

    container.xml, yang masuk dalam sub-direktori

    META-INF). Kami ingin pergi ke direktori bekas dan pastikan ia mempunyai nama yang mencerminkan nama tajuk dan pengarang.

  22. Sebaik sahaja anda mempunyai direktori fail bernama bagaimana anda mahu, anda harus menggunakan program arkib fail zip untuk zip direktori. Direktori sampel saya berakhir sebagai fail zip bernama "Cara Membangun Laman Web - Jennifer Kyrnin.zip"
  23. Akhir sekali, tukar lanjutan nama fail dari

    .zip kepada

    .epub. Sistem operasi anda boleh membantah, tetapi teruskan dengannya. Anda mahu ini mempunyai sambungan epub.

  24. Akhir sekali, menguji buku anda.Sukar untuk mendapatkan format epub yang betul pada percubaan pertama, jadi anda harus selalu menguji fail anda. Buka dalam pembaca epub seperti Kaliber. Dan jika ia tidak dipaparkan dengan betul, anda boleh menggunakan Kaliber untuk membetulkan masalah.